Selecting a 3PL partner in: Kalangala requires balancing remote‑island constraints with multimodal connectivity and cost controls. The district’s archipelago on Lake Victoria shifts emphasis from long‑haul trucking to barge, ferry and feeder vessel operations, creating opportunities for specialized warehousing—cold chain for fisheries, consolidated cross‑dock hubs for eCommerce, and last‑mile inventory positioned close to island communities.

Leading providers in: Kalangala integrate vessel schedules with mainland gateways, provide transfer and berthing capacity, and deliver inventory visibility plus SLA‑driven fulfillment models that reduce dwell time and lower landed cost for B2B and omnichannel operations.

Frequently Asked Questions


Prioritize multimodal transfer experience (barge/ferry handling), secure berthing and stevedoring, cold‑chain if needed, reliable inventory visibility (WMS) and proven contingency planning for weather and vessel schedule variability.

Transit times to island end‑customers are typically shorter from a local Kalangala hub, reducing last‑mile delivery windows and stockouts. Overall landed cost can be lower when factoring reduced last‑mile transport and consolidated inbound shipments, though barge rates and transfer handling must be modeled.

Negotiate SLAs for vessel transfer windows, order‑to‑ship cycle times, cold‑chain temperature controls, inventory accuracy, dispute resolution timelines, and contingency plans for bad weather and berth availability.

Yes—experienced 3PLs can support omnichannel returns, pick‑pack, kitting and B2B pallet moves, but brands should expect limitations in peak capacity during bad weather, potential longer inbound lead times from international origins, and the need for shore transfer coordination.

Include barge/ferry line‑haul and handling fees, berthing/stevedoring charges, specialized equipment costs (cold storage, ramps), contingency inventory buffers, insurance for water transport, and WMS/Warehouse labor differentials compared to mainland rates.
